- Selection from Designing Embedded Hardware 2nd. Floppy Disk Controller 2.


Von Neumann Architecture Computer Science Gcse Guru

Ad Get the most powerful professional diagram software on the market.

Computer architecture diagram isa. Instruction Set Architecture ISA The Instruction Set Architecture ISA is the part of the processor that is visible to the programmer or compiler writer. You will have to look at the characteristics of the principal components that make up your computer system ways in which these computer systems are interconnected and how information flows between these components. The ISA of a processor can be described using 5 catagories.

Technology Applications Computer. To command the computer you need to speak its language and the instructions are. Generally computer architecture consists of the following.

Effective use of pipelining Example. Aspects of ISAs RISC vs. Computers do not understand high-level programming languages such as Java C or most programming languages used.

The only way that you can interact with the hardware is the instruction set of the processor. The diagram given below depicts the computer architecture. We will briefly describe the instruction sets found in many of the microprocessors used today.

The ISA as defined by Computer Architecture. ISA Instruction Set Architecture Microarchitecture Logic Transistors PhysicsChemistry compute the fibonacci sequence fori2. Hard Disk Drive controller 3.

So the instruction set architecture is basically the interface between your hardware and the software. An important embodiment of semantics is the instruction set architecture ISA of the system. For Example Intel developed the x86 architecture ARM developed the ARM architecture AMD developed the amd64 architecture.

Instruction Set Architecture ISA In computer organization and architecture the instruction set architecture ISA is defined as a set of binary commands supported by the processor chip. A processor only understands instructions encoded in some numerical. All the above parts are connected with the help of system bus which consists of address bus data bus and control bus.

The ISA is the level which a compiler targets although optimisations are sensitive to the micro-architecture particularly in terms of optimum scheduling. Introduction 29 Abstraction Layering and Computers Computer architecture Definition of ISA to facilitate implementation of software layers This course mostly on computer micro-architecture Design Processor Memory IO to implement ISA Touch on compilers OS n 1 circuits n -1 as well. These notes summarize a few items of interest about these two ISAs.

Click More Templates and you can see a great number of architecture diagram templates that are created by Edraw and our users. I ai ai-1ai-2 load r1 ai. The ISA is a logical usually binary representative encoding of the basic set of distinct operations that a computer architecture may perform and by which application programs specify the useful work to be done.

An Introduction to Computer Architecture Each machine has its own unique personality which probably could be defined as the intuitive sum total of everything you know and feel. ISA Wars RISC Reduced Instruction Set Computer. 11 rows Memory model and memory addressing is the third part of Instruction Set.

Instruction Set Architectures 2 Instruction Set Architecture ISA What is a good ISA. The PC and PC XT block diagram A typical system used four expansion slots 1. Each processor chip design is based on the specific Instruction set architecture ISA.

Add r2 r2 r1. EGA or VGA display controller adapter 2. Let us see the example structure of Computer Architecture as given below.

Instruction Set Architecture CI 50 MartinRoth. Computer organization as we pointed out earlier is the realization of the instruction set architecture. Types of ISA Complex instruction set computer CISC Many instructions several hundreds An instruction takes many cycles to execute Example.

The ISA specifies what the processor is capable of doing and the ISA how it gets accomplished. Actually Intel 64 was invented by AMD who called it x86-64. The ISA is a simplified but sufficient definition of the hardware interface.

The RISC-V ISA developed by UC Berkeley is an example of an Open Source ISA. The Branch of Computer Architecture is more inclined towards the Analysis and Design of Instruction Set Architecture. Up to 5 cash back Chapter 1.

Intel Pentium Reduced instruction set computer RISC Small set of instructions Simple instructions each executes in one clock cycle almost. Launch the EdrawMax on the desktop or open EdrawMax Online on the browser. Use Lucidchart to visualize ideas make charts diagrams more.

A Quantitative Approach is created within. µISA Application OS Compiler Firmware CPU IO Memory Digital Circuits Gates Transistors. How to Create a Computer Architecture Diagram.

The ISA document is the boundary between the software and hardware implementation in the computer system. Navigate to Basic Basic Diagram Block Diagram. Introduction to Computer Architecture Unit 2.

The Display adapter 4. CS352 Spring 2010 Lecture 1 8 What is Computer Architecture. The IA-32 is the instruction set architecture ISA of Intels most successful line of 32-bit processors and the Intel 64 ISA is its extension into 64-bit processors.

Combined Serial and Parallel Port Adapter 8 The PC AT ISA block diagram 8 slots with two usually used 1. Egisters A B S F G D S G S D What is a Computer System. ISA wsmaller number of simple instructions RISC hardware only needs to do a few simple things wellthus RISC ISAs make it easier to design fast power-efficient hardware RISC ISAs usually have fixed-sized instructions and a loadstore architecture Ex.

An instruction set architecture ISA is the interface between the computers software and hardware and also can be viewed as the programmers view of the machine. The ISA serves as the boundary between software and hardware.


Pipelined Architecture With Its Diagram Geeksforgeeks